when I pulled the airfilter box I noticed the cold air intake has a throttle of sorts... what is it, and how does it open and close? could it be closing in the OP's car limiting the intake of air for the turbo to pressureize?
|
That's a somewhat mechanical airflow meter. Airflow pushes the flap which registers as an electrical signal for the EDS. You can ditch it if you've disabled EGR and ARV, but it's part of the structural attachment of the air cleaner.
